Essential Skills for Aspiring Bookmakers

So, now that you know more about the world of bookmaking in general, let’s see what some of the most essential skills you’ll need to possess if you intend to be successful.

1. Grasping Probabilities and Odds

Understanding probabilities is deciphering the language of the game, to put it simply. It's about knowing the likelihood of an event happening and then translating that into odds. It’s being fluent in the betting dialect, so to speak.

2. Assessing Risk and Reward

Bookmaking is a game of calculated risks. It’s not about avoiding risks altogether, of course, but strategically navigating them. Assessing risk means weighing the potential rewards against the potential downsides. Successful bookmakers know how to balance on the edge, and how to make decisions that will maximize their gains and minimize their losses.

3. Statistical Proficiency

Statistics are the backbone of bookmaking. And, statistical proficiency goes far beyond basic arithmetic. This is about understanding trends and identifying outliers, and only then making predictions. It does sound a bit tricky, but this sixth sense for numbers that allows you to read between the statistical lines is something you’ll need practice to develop.

4. Adaptability in Dynamic Markets

The betting market is a dynamic world of its own. Its future is always influenced by unexpected events and constantly changing odds. Here, being adaptable means staying ahead of the curve. So, you need to adjust your strategies in real time to meet the demands of a market that's constantly in flux.

5. Critical Thinking Under Pressure

Imagine this scenario: you’re a bookmaker and it's the final quarter. So, bets are pouring in, and decisions need to be made. Critical thinking under pressure is your ability to stay cool while you make strategic choices and adapt swiftly when or if the game intensifies. It's the skill that turns pressure into a catalyst for success. Although you may not be natural at this, you will become more rational in your decisions even if the pressure is unbelievably high, but it will take some practice.

6. Ethical Decision-Making

Lastly, in an industry where trust is very important, ethical decision-making should always be your guiding principle. Always operate within legal boundaries and be fair, and you’ll build a reputation as a trustworthy bookmaker. So, don’t just play by the rules – set the rules for fair play yourself.
